The Snowies is well served by a network of sealed roads boasting spectacular scenery. These are all great riding roads. Ensure you ride the loop of towns: Cooma, Berridale, Jindabyne, Thredbo, Khancoban, Tumbarumba, Batlow, Tumut and Adaminaby.
The Snowy Mountains area can be accessed from either Canberra or Tumut in the north, Bega on the coast and Albury to the west.

When travelling by car, the Snowy Mountains Drive is a great touring route to explore the region in all its glory. This is a drive like no other: the country's highest mountains; some of the most diverse flora and fauna; towns bursting with historic and cultural stories and it's the home of some of Australia's most famous icons.
The Snowies is well served by a network of sealed roads boasting spectacular scenery. Ensure you drive the loop of towns: Bredbo, Cooma, Berridale, Jindabyne, Thredbo, Khancoban, Tumbarumba, Batlow, Tumut and Adaminaby. From each town, you can visit attractions and settlements nearby and learn the history by being surrounded by it.
The Snowy Mountains area can be accessed from Canberra in the north, Bega on the coast and Albury to the west.
